Braised Chickpea Stew
Ingredients
- 1/2 lb1/2 lb1/2 lb Italian Sausage, Mild, (see notes)

- 1 cup1 cup1 cup Chickpeas
- 2/3 cup2/3 cup2/3 cup Bell Pepper, diced (see notes)
- 2/3 cup2/3 cup2/3 cup Onion, diced (see notes)
- 2/3 cup2/3 cup2/3 cup Carrots, diced (see notes)
- 8.5 oz8.5 oz8.5 oz Mediterranean Inspired Flavor Starter Sauce - Mesa de Vida, 1 bottle (or Creole, Latin, or Moroccan Starter Sauce)

- 1 cup1 cup1 cup Chicken Broth, (or your favorite broth, see notes))

- 14.5 oz14.5 oz14.5 oz Diced Tomatoes, 1 can (optional)
- Salt, to taste/health needs

-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Combine ingredients in an oven-safe pot.
- Cover and oven-braise for 45 minutes to 1 hour.
- If you’d like the top of your ingredients to brown, remove the lid during the last 30 minutes of cooking.
- Remove from the oven and rest with the lid on for 10 minutes before serving.
Notes
Adjust the protein ratio according to preference or what you have available. // Feel free to replace with any veggies you have on hand or prefer! // You can use your favorite broth, or wine, or combination of the two (Use 2 cups if you prefer more sauce)
